Deconstructing the Bonus Mechanics
- Deposit match – usually 100% up to a cap, but the cap is often lower than your intended stake.
- Free spins – limited to low‑variance games; high‑variance slots like Gonzo’s Quest are off‑limits.
- Cashback – promised as a safety net but paid out only after you’ve lost a certain amount.
Look at the math. A 100% match on a $100 deposit gives you $200 to play. However, a 30x wagering requirement on that $200 means you must place $6,000 in bets before you can touch a penny. Most players never get there because the games are designed to bleed them dry. The “free” label is a marketing ploy, not a charitable act. No casino is in the business of giving away cash; they’re in the business of keeping it.

How to Navigate the Minefield Without Losing Your Shirt
First, treat every bonus code as a math problem. Plug the numbers into a spreadsheet: deposit amount, match percentage, wagering multiplier, max bet, game restriction. If the required turnover exceeds what you’re comfortable wagering, walk away. The only time a bonus ever feels worthwhile is when the required playthrough is low enough that you could realistically meet it without draining your bankroll.
Second, stick to games you actually enjoy, not the ones the casino forces you onto. If you love the fast pace of Gonzo’s Quest, don’t let a bonus push you onto a slower slot just because it’s “approved”. The enjoyment factor is the only variable you can control.

Third, keep an eye on the withdrawal timetable. Some operators take weeks to process a payout, especially when you’re cashing out winnings earned from a bonus. The delay is another hidden cost that can turn a seemingly generous offer into a nightmare.
Finally, remember that “free” is a word they use to bait you, not a guarantee of profit. The house always wins, and the only way to keep it from eating you alive is to stay disciplined, read the fine print, and never assume a bonus code is a free ticket to wealth.
